Arunachal Pradesh Gears Up for the Premier Football Extravaganza – Registration Open Until December 2nd!

The excitement is building up as the Arunachal Football Association (AFA), in collaboration with the Eagle Welfare Association (EWA), gears up to host the 8th edition of the prestigious Eagle Trophy Football Championship. Kipa Ajay, Secretary General of the Arunachal Olympic Association, announced that the highly anticipated tournament is scheduled to take place from December 10th to 23rd, 2023, at R.G Stadium, Naharlagun.

The Eagle Trophy Football Championship is renowned as one of the most prestigious and popular football events in the state. Teams from various districts and clubs will converge to compete fiercely for the coveted trophy and substantial cash prizes. The championship, featuring the Sr. Men’s Category, will adhere to a knockout format, with each match lasting 90 minutes.

Teams eager to be part of this thrilling football extravaganza are urged to register at the earliest opportunity. Registration forms will be made available starting November 20th, 2023, at the AFA Office, Golden Jubilee Outdoor Stadium, Yupia, during regular office hours. The deadline for team registration is set for December 2nd, 2023.

The Eagle Welfare Association (EWA), a pioneering sports society established in 1981, holds the distinction of being the oldest sports organisers in Arunachal Pradesh. Notably, they introduced the Club Tournament in the state and have consistently supported the organization of the Eagle Trophy Football Tournament throughout the years. Shri Tadar Appa, President of the EWA, extended his best wishes to all participating teams and conveyed EWA support to the Arunachal Football Association for the seamless conduct of the tournament.
